Clark Forklift Parts - Performing worldwide, there are at this time 350,000 Clark forklifts and lift trucks in operation, with more than 250,000 of those in commission in North America. Clark has five major lines of forklifts across the world, making it one of the most expansive organizations in the industry. Heavy duty trucks ranging from 1,500lb to 18,000lb capacities, duel fuel, petrol, LPG, hand powered lift trucks, narrow-aisle stackers and electric riders are some of their specialties.
Clark Totalift, handles more than 120,000 specific items built for 20 distinctive models of lift trucks and automated equipment. Your regional Clark Dealer is your complete source for availability of all your parts requirements supplied by Clark Totalift.
Clark's phenomenal Parts Distribution Centers are conveniently stationed in Louisville, Kentucky, which serves both their customers and sellers in North America, and Changwon, South Korea, which handles their Asian dealers and consumers. Internationally, Clark has one of the most impressive dealer support networks. With over 550 locations worldwide, dealer representation in over 80 countries and 230 locations in North America, their high level of dedication to their customers predominates the material handling market.
By revolutionizing the operator restraint system safety feature, Clark proudly remains a leader of innovation in the industrial equipment and automated lift truck industry. This exceptional commitment to safety is now a standard feature on every lift truck.
Clark's recurrent mission to possess the No. 1 Quality system in the industry is proudly demonstrated by ISO 9001 - Clark, is the first lift truck manufacturer across the world to be certified with the globally accepted quality standard ISO 9001 for each and every one of their manufacturing facilities. Also, the ISO 14001 Environmental Management System certificate was awarded to Clark's Korean facility in 2001.
